Bioluminescent is a term that refers to the ability of living organisms to produce light. This phenomenon is observed in a wide range of organisms, including bacteria, fungi, fish, and insects. Bioluminescence is a fascinating natural process that has captured the attention of scientists and the public alike. If you are interested in using the word bioluminescent in your writing, here are some tips to help you do so effectively.


1. Understand the meaning of bioluminescent Before you can use the word bioluminescent in a sentence, it is important to understand what it means. Bioluminescence is the production and emission of light by living organisms. This process is achieved through the interaction of a light-producing molecule called luciferin and an enzyme called luciferase. Bioluminescence is used by organisms for a variety of purposes, including communication, camouflage, and attracting prey.

All the parts of speech in English are used to make sentences. All sentences include two parts: the subject and the verb (this is also known as the predicate). The subject is the person or thing that does something or that is described in the sentence. The verb is the action the person or thing takes or the description of the person or thing. If a sentence doesn’t have a subject and a verb, it is not a complete sentence (e.g., In the sentence “Went to bed,” we don’t know who went to bed).



Four Types Of Sentence Structure.

Simple Sentences With "Bioluminescent"

A simple sentence with "Bioluminescent"contains a subject and a verb, and it may also have an object and modifiers. However, it contains only one independent clause.

Compound Sentences With "Bioluminescent"

A compound sentence with "Bioluminescent" contains at least two independent clauses. These two independent clauses can be combined with a comma and a coordinating conjunction or with a semicolon.

Complex Sentences With "Bioluminescent"

A complex sentence with "Bioluminescent" contains at least one independent clause and at least one dependent clause. Dependent clauses can refer to the subject (who, which) the sequence/time (since, while), or the causal elements (because, if) of the independent clause.

Compound-Complex Sentences With "Bioluminescent"

Sentence types can also be combined. A compound-complex sentence with "Bioluminescent" contains at least two independent clauses and at least one dependent clause.
